About The Position

The Office Manager provides leadership and oversight for the daily administrative operations of the parish office, ensuring a welcoming, organized, responsive, and efficient environment for parishioners, visitors, volunteers, clergy, and staff. This position leads the front office function and directly supervises the Receptionists and Parish Data Specialist. The Office Manager is responsible for ensuring effective front office operations, parish administrative processes, calendar and facility coordination, records management, and data administration. Working closely with the Director of Parish Operations, the Office Manager establishes effective administrative systems, develops staff, improves processes, and ensures a high standard of hospitality, accuracy, responsiveness, and service throughout the parish office.
